The Nigerian Upstream Petroleum Regulatory Commission (NUPRC) has instructed winners of the 2022/2023 Mini Bid Round and the 2024 Licensing Round to accelerate the development of their newly awarded petroleum assets.

The regulator emphasized the need for swift execution to translate licensing awards into tangible production gains.

This directive follows the formal execution of concession contracts for 19 Petroleum Prospecting Licences (PPLs) awarded in the 2024 bid round.

The licenses were granted to 12 winning companies, marking a significant step in Nigeria’s efforts to revitalize its upstream sector.

The NUPRC’s push for rapid development aligns with broader government goals to increase domestic oil and gas output and reduce reliance on mature fields.

The regulatory pressure comes as major international players continue to commit capital to Nigerian projects.
